About Falcon Finance

Falcon Finance is developing a universal collateral infrastructure that transforms any liquid asset—such as digital assets, currency-backed tokens, and tokenized real-world assets—into USD-pegged on-chain liquidity. The native token of the protocol, FF, serves as a gateway to governance, staking rewards, community incentives, and exclusive access to unique products and features.

About Tezos

Tezos is a blockchain network that’s based on smart contracts, in a way that’s not too dissimilar to Ethereum. The big difference is Tezos aims to offer infrastructure that is more advanced — meaning it can evolve and improve over time without there ever being a danger of a hard fork. This open-source platform also bills itself as “secure, upgradable and built to last” — and says its smart contract language provides the accuracy that is required for high-value use cases.
